Destiny Is Not Fixed — It Is a Movement You Must Participate In


Destiny Is Not Fixed — It Is a Movement You Must Participate In

Most people believe destiny is something that comes to them.
Something written. Something imposed. Something that “happens.”

But if destiny were truly fixed, your consciousness would be irrelevant.
Your effort would be meaningless.
Your choice would be unnecessary.

And yet, every day you choose.
You plan.
You react.
You resist.
You aspire.

So clearly, destiny is not a rigid script.

What people call destiny is often just a refined word for helplessness. When life feels overwhelming, it is convenient to say, “It is my destiny.” This becomes a subtle insurance policy against responsibility.

But existence does not operate on your excuses.


Destiny or Tendencies?

Look closely at your life.

You wake up, follow certain habits, drink your coffee or tea according to preference, go to work, react to situations, and return home. If destiny were fixed, this pattern should repeat identically for years.

But it doesn’t.

One day the coffee lover drinks tea.
One day the tea lover chooses coffee.
Situations shift. Relationships shift. You shift.

What you call destiny is mostly tendencies — psychological patterns formed by memory. You like certain things and call them “me.” You dislike certain things and push them away. First you speak of destiny, then you selectively edit it according to your preferences. Naturally, this creates inner conflict.

Destiny is not your habit.
Destiny is movement.


The Universe Moves — It Does Not Intend

Existence functions by movement, not by intention.

This movement has no personal agenda. It simply moves. As it moves, it demands certain qualities of you — sometimes inertia (tamas), sometimes balance (sattva), sometimes intense action (rajas). Nature shifts. Circumstances shift. The human system shifts.

You call this shift destiny.

But destiny is not the event.
It is the movement behind the event.

This movement carries memory. And memory creates the experience of time — past, present, future.

What has happened.
What is happening.
What may happen next.

But what you call destiny is only a tiny fragment of the next moment. Existence is far larger than your prediction of tomorrow.


Destiny Is Like a Radio Frequency



Imagine countless radio stations broadcasting simultaneously. All frequencies are present in the air. You sit at home with your radio set and tune in to one channel.

The broadcast is not limited.
Your receiver is.

Some radios can catch subtle frequencies that ordinary sets cannot — not because the universe favors them, but because the instrument is refined.

The human system is such a receiver — a transformer between the manifest and the unmanifest.

Right now, most human beings are not upgrading the instrument. They are operating with an old kit and calling its limitations “destiny.”

That is not destiny.
That is lack of refinement.

If something stagnates, it becomes disease. When there is no conscious evolution, distortion begins. If you do not refine body, mind, emotion, and energy, life cannot open new possibilities. It will keep replaying the same limited frequencies.

Yoga is the science of upgrading the receiver.

When the system is fully refined, you do not need advice for life. You perceive directly. You do not guess what is right — you know. That clarity is not belief. It is perception.

That is yoga.


Everything Is Destiny — But Not in the Way You Think



Gautama, the Buddha once indicated something profound: when life offers you something, whether it becomes part of you or you walk away from it depends on how you hold life.

In that sense, everything is destiny.

Where you are born.
What situation arises today.
Who meets you.
Who leaves you.

Situations will come because life is in motion.

Your mother may scold you.
Your partner may walk away.
A loved one may die.
A sudden opportunity may appear.

Events will happen.

But how you respond determines whether you remain trapped in tendencies or participate in the larger unfolding of life.

Life is co-creation.


The Mystery of Support and Grace

Suppose I am hungry but have no money. From somewhere, someone arrives and feeds me. Not because of magic — but because the broadcast is active. Whoever receives that frequency becomes the instrument.

My Guru used to say:

Saap kare na chaakri, panchhi kare na kaam,
Das Maluka kah gaye, sabke daata Ram.

The snake has no job.
The bird has no employment.
Yet existence sustains them.

Today I may have no wealth, but I may offer you enlightenment.
Today you may have education and money.

We stand at different points in the movement.

When I am hungry, you are destined to bring food to my plate.
When the time ripens, I am destined to bring clarity into your life.

Destiny is not punishment.
It is participation.


Upgrade the Instrument

Human beings are not limited by fate. They are limited by the refinement of their system.

If you do not consciously evolve, life feels random.
If you refine yourself, life feels intelligent.

When perception becomes total, you no longer debate destiny. You align with movement. You become receptive to grace, capable of action, and free from helplessness.

Destiny is not something written about you.

It is the vast movement of existence —
and your willingness to participate in it consciously.

Refine the instrument.
Tune into a higher frequency.
Then destiny is no longer a cage — it becomes a doorway.
